The City Council recently provided a list of possible amendments to its advisory committee, which will research and make recommendations. ... WebStep 4: Mayoral decision. After a bill is passed by the Council, it is presented to the Mayor, who has 30 days to either sign the bill into law, veto the bill or take no action. If the Mayor vetoes the bill, it is sent back to the Council. If this happens, the Council can override the Mayor’s veto with a 2/3 vote. WebIf the Mayor vetoes the legislation, the Council must reconsider the legislation and approve it by two-thirds vote of the Council in order for it to become effective. Once the Mayor has approved the legislation or the Council has overridden the Mayor’s veto, the legislation is assigned an Act number. Not done yet… the final steps to enactment. WebMar 3, 2024 · A mayor in a mayor-council city can veto an ordinance passed by the council but this veto is only authorized for ordinances, not for any other council action (see RCW 35A.12.100 ). A mayor cannot veto contracts that are authorized by motion, but may …
